Hans Hateboer (born January 9, 1994 in Beerta ) is a Dutch football player who has been under contract with Atalanta Bergamo since 2017 . He plays as a right full-back and has been part of the Dutch national football team since March 2018 .

Career

In the club

Hateboer came to the first team from the youth of FC Groningen , for which he made his Eredivisie debut against Vitesse Arnhem on October 27, 2013 . In his second season he won the Dutch Cup with Groningen , after which the team played in the UEFA Europa League the following season .

In January 2017 Hateboer moved to Atalanta Bergamo in Italy for € 1.5 million . In the 2017/18 season, his second for Atalanta, the team reached the intermediate round of the Europa League, where it was eliminated by Borussia Dortmund .

In the national team

On March 23, 2018, Hans Hateboer made his senior national team debut in a friendly against England , where he was part of the starting line-up.
